Trigger syntax for Lead Convert trigger?

I would like to create an workflow apprvoal for lead convertion into account i want to achieve the below.

1. Sales want to convert lead to account, they submit the case to another department approval
2. The concerned department receive approval request
3. If concern deparmtnet approved the reuqest the lead need to be converted automatically into an account.
4. if concerened department reject then sales will receive a notification of the rejection adn lead will not be converted.

I would like your help on how i can achieve the above in sales force specially once approved how to automatically convert the lead?”